Output 68c830bd263253933f143a2c3f295ae6a4b25c27b662284bfde8d05e0eb84b4d:1

value
330080
script pubkey
OP_0 OP_PUSHBYTES_20 95a72b31907ccb7dc01d7c98c2a561bc20fc6e9f
address
ltc1qjknjkvvs0n9hmsqa0jvv9ftphss0cm5lw57f8j
transaction
68c830bd263253933f143a2c3f295ae6a4b25c27b662284bfde8d05e0eb84b4d
spent
true